If you neglect to make your mortgage payments to your lender, foreclosure of sell my Baltimore house fast your premises might occur. Do not quit paying your debts, and don’t wait until you cannot make payments before you act. Not paying anything, is only going to hurt your credit more. Many banks and private lenders will offer different repayment programs. Do not wait around until it is too late! Take action and do your research to find out what is our there to get you out of your financial jam. Assuming you make all of the necessary payments up to the close of the repayment program, you’ll avoid foreclosure and keep your property.

The foreclosure procedure is not very hard to comprehend. In general, completing the foreclosure procedure can take from 6 months to over a year. The banks tend to take a long time to get a foreclosed home off of their books. There’s a lot of things that have to happen before your home is completely taken away from you.

If you need to foreclose on a house, the procedure is somewhat complicated and the steps have to be followed exactly, or the entire process might have to be repeated. If you’re on the lookout for a home to reside in, an auction is most likely not the best way to go in most cases. You can list your house with a realtor, but that can take time. You may not have to move from your house right away after a foreclosure sale. Many times, there is a period of time before you must vacate the premises, but this varies from state to state.

In the event the homeowners are in the middle of a foreclosure, a Chapter 7 filing will block the foreclosure process. For this to happen, the individual must be living in the property that is in foreclosure, and all borrowers listed on the note must agree to participate in mediation. The homeowner won’t qualify if they’re in bankruptcy. So, the homeowners get to continue living in their residence and keep their cars, along with certain other assets. Chapter 7 is very complicated, and you should consult an attorney before ever considering filing for it.

If the foreclosure is going forward, the lending company will file foreclosure documents in a neighborhood court. The lender would have to file a lawsuit with the court and prove that they have taken the necessary steps to remedy the situation and collect any debts still owed to them. The home will usually bid out at the auction and the debtor is still responsible for the balance due plus any foreclosure costs. As stated earlier, this is a long drawn out process, so you should make every effort to settle the matter long before it ever reaches this point.
